The Power of Open Source Family Trees
Family trees have long been a cherished tool for genealogists and history enthusiasts seeking to uncover their roots and understand their heritage. In recent years, the concept of open source family trees has revolutionized the way we research and document our familial connections.
Open source family trees refer to collaborative platforms where individuals can share, edit, and expand upon genealogical information freely. These digital repositories allow users from around the world to contribute their knowledge, research findings, and personal stories to create a comprehensive network of interconnected family histories.
One of the key advantages of open source family trees is the democratization of genealogical research. By breaking down traditional barriers to information sharing, these platforms empower individuals with diverse backgrounds and expertise to come together in a shared pursuit of uncovering their familial past.
Furthermore, open source family trees enable real-time collaboration among researchers. Users can cross-reference data, correct errors, and fill in missing pieces of the puzzle collectively. This dynamic exchange of information not only enhances the accuracy of individual family trees but also contributes to a more robust and interconnected genealogical landscape.
Moreover, open source family trees promote transparency and accessibility in genealogical research. By making data openly available to all users, these platforms foster a culture of knowledge sharing and mutual learning. Individuals can benefit from the collective wisdom of the community while also contributing their unique insights to enrich the overall database.

Which family tree site is free?
When seeking a free family tree site, individuals often inquire about platforms that offer comprehensive genealogical tools and resources without requiring a subscription fee. Many popular open source family tree websites, such as FamilySearch, WikiTree, and Gramps, provide users with the ability to create and explore family trees at no cost. These free platforms not only offer access to vast databases of historical records and collaborative features but also promote a spirit of community-driven research and knowledge sharing among genealogists worldwide. By choosing a free family tree site, individuals can embark on their genealogical journey without financial constraints while benefiting from the wealth of information and support available within these inclusive online communities.

How do I open a gedcom file for free?
Opening a GEDCOM file for free is a common query among individuals seeking to explore their family history through genealogical research. To access a GEDCOM file at no cost, you can utilize various online platforms and software applications specifically designed for this purpose. Popular options include genealogy websites, open-source family tree software, and online GEDCOM viewers that allow you to import and view GEDCOM files without any charges. By leveraging these free resources, you can seamlessly unlock the valuable information stored within GEDCOM files and delve deeper into your ancestral roots with ease and affordability.
